Spurs fans on Twitter have flocked to a tweet from Harry Kane after he shared his excitement for football’s imminent return. 

The 26-year-old shared a photo of himself looking overjoyed in training at Hotspur Way, with the caption: “Football is back soon” which has delighted a lot of Spurs fans on Twitter. It was confirmed earlier in the week by Jose Mourinho that the England captain is back fit and will be ready for the Premier League’s restart next month.

Before his hamstring injury in January, the academy graduate had been in sensational form for the North London club, having averaged a superb 7.30 rating for his performances in the Premier League, contributing 11 goals and two assists in 20 appearances in the top-flight (per WhoScored).

The striker expressed concerns earlier in the lockdown period that if the Premier League couldn’t be completed by the end of June then it should be voided, however, he is clearly excited to have it back.

Some Spurs fans urged their striker to push on and try and win the golden boot, although his 11 goals leave him eight behind current top-scorer Jamie Vardy (per BBC).
